Floating Net Asset Value.
Accounting adjustments to mark the fair value to the price that would be received to sell an asset or paid to transfer a liability
 
A form of money market fund whose distributing shares maintain a floating price through the marking to market the value of the investments held in its portfolio.
 
The same as Variable net asset value.
